DH and I stayed in a Family Suite at All Star Music ( a value resort) in Sept. of 2006.

We really enjoyed the Queen size bed, the kitchenette with the microwave, having a sofa and cushioned chair to sit on and relax after a day at the parks before retiring for the evening.

I thought the pullouts very comfortable.

They are designed so the back cushion and seat cushion of the pullout support the pullout. There is no metal bar to hurt the sleepers back.

Are you considering January 08 or January 09. These suites book quickly. There may not be any available for January 08. I would call ASAP to check.
If you are used to a full vacation home, I think you will fiind the size of the Family Suites small. It is the size of 2 small hotel rooms together.

how many will the suite sleep? From the floor plan it looks like it is only designed to sleep 4.

It sleeps 6 people plus a child under 3 in a pac-n-play.
The Queen size bed in the master area sleeps 2, the pull out sofa sleeps two. Plus the chair and the ottoman will pull out each sleeping 1 more person.
